Output 4e17c59e8512951ea11f8a3693e2f199c7a8c5481732b7cce1da7e1b328b3e87:2

value
628400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69371fef1e8ced93717e70150c4351c93ae05414 OP_EQUAL
address
3BHLupXQ9RbbarfkP7R7uetrRBwv6kwfH5
transaction
4e17c59e8512951ea11f8a3693e2f199c7a8c5481732b7cce1da7e1b328b3e87
spent
true